Juan Villalonga and Adrián de la Joya . Here are the two people who introduced Commissioner José Manuel Villarejo - retired on June 22, 2016 and investigated since November 3, 2017 for leading an alleged criminal bribery and laundering organization - in the millionaires jet set , according to the facts investigated and confirmed to this newspaper sources close to the investigation open to this former police officer.

"Long-term partners" of the commissioner, as they are considered by the Anti-Corruption Prosecutor and recognized by the investigating judge of this case, Manuel García Castellón , in relation to De la Joya, whom he described as "a long-distance partner" in several cars dictated in the piece that investigates the works that Villarejo did for the Spanish businessmen Ángel and Álvaro Pérez-Maura .

It is precisely in the summary of this piece where there are transcripts of conversations held by Villarejo with people identified by the Internal Affairs Unit of the National Police such as Villalonga and De la Joya. These files reveal the existence of an alleged "team" whose members "plan different business options", according to reports sent by this police unit to the Central Court of Instruction number 6 of the National Court.

- "No, what I wanted to say is that we are a team, right?" Says Villalonga.

- "Semos, let's be a team," Villarejo replies to the one who was president of Telefónica between 1997 and 2000 - currently, business advisor - in a conversation held in New York on February 8, 2017 on the occasion of the work commissioned by the Pérez-Maura.

The retired commissioner comes to describe Villalonga as "a brilliant guy, but that is a disaster for business and politics," according to the Internal Affairs transcript of another conversation held by the commissioner two days later, also in New York, with De la Joya and two other interlocutors.

"Villarejo says that the presence of Juan in the project is to cache them" e "indicates that Juan was the one who transformed the shit of telecommunications company they had to what it is now", in reference to Telefónica. "Villarejo comments that Juan had to leave Spain for envy and for being a friend of the president - of whom he was a school desk companion -", referring to José María Aznar . "Juan is the team for all things," concludes the commissioner.

According to another of the reports provided, Villalonga himself says in a conversation with Villarejo and De la Joya that he is grateful to Telefónica "because thanks to them you can access anyone in the world with three or four calls, even if you don't know him, he reaches they".

To date, his name has appeared in two of the 13 open pieces in the Villarejo case . First, in the so-called piece Carol , concerning the commission that the German businesswoman Corinna zu Sayn-Wittgenstein made to the commissioner to advise the Goldsmith British family before an investigation opened by the Treasury for the purchase of a property in Ronda (Malaga). Precisely, that commission was made in a conversation between Villalonga, Corinna and Villarejo, in which reference was also made to events related to King Emeritus Juan Carlos I.

The other piece is in the so-called PIT , which investigates the works of the Pérez-Maura and for which the other "long-distance partner" of the former police officer, Adrián de la Joya, was accused. In fact, this is the only one of the two alleged partners of the commissioner who is being investigated in the Villarejo case. Sources close to the case told this newspaper that the judge does not rule out calling Villalonga.

De la Joya is identified by investigators as the person who contacted Paul Manafort - former director of the election campaign of the president of the United States, Donald Trump - so that he allegedly participated in the project hired by Pérez-Maura.

In his statement before the judge on May 10, De la Joya, residing in Geneva (Switzerland) - he is now prohibited from leaving Spain - said he met Villarejo in 2014. "At the beginning it was a relationship that made me intoxicated. little and then I became friends with him and when he came to Spain I called him and went to his office, we were going to eat, he told me stories. He was very entertaining. "

He recognized the judge not to use credit cards and have a good "economic position." "I don't have it bad and I don't need to do crap with Mr. Villarejo," he said. "It is going to seem like a frivolity what I am going to tell you, but for me it was entertainment, because I get bored in Spain when I come, I have nothing to do. I went there [to Villarejo's office] and got into a meeting. If I could help him, maybe I helped him, "he acknowledged.
